In the past Diane showed me how to use two attributes of the Android
manifest in order to get ActivityGroups working properly (i.e. all the
apps whose activities will be combined using the ActivityGroup will be
accessible) - those attributes are 'sharedUserId' and 'signature'.

This is what I had working in the past:

<manifest x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android";
        package="com.frogdesign.desktop"
        android:sharedUserId="android.uid.system"
        android:signature="android.signature.system">
...

With the beta SDK that was just released, this mechanism is broken, as
the 'signature' attribute is no longer valid.  Please advise on how to
implement ActivityGroups where Activities are in different apps with
the new SDK.

The docs still indicate that the signature is still required for
userid match to occur:
http://code.google.com/android/reference/android/R.styleable.html#AndroidManifest

... and in the logs I see:

>From the console:
[2008-08-19 17:26:52 - FrogDesktop] Installation error:
INSTALL_FAILED_SHARED_USER_INCOMPATIBLE

>From logcat:
DEBUG/PackageManager(56): Scanning package com.frogdesign.desktop
DEBUG/PackageManager(56): Shared UserID android.uid.system (uid=1000):
packages=[PackageSetting{433aa490 com.frogdesign.desktop/1000},
PackageSetting{43540b50 com.frogdesign.desktop/1000},
PackageSetting{434275a0 com.android.providers.settings/1000},
PackageSetting{434eeea0 android/1000}]
ERROR/PackageManager(56): Package com.frogdesign.desktop has no
signatures that match those in shared user android.uid.system;
ignoring!
WARN/PackageManager(56): Package couldn't be installed in /data/app/
com.frogdesign.desktop.apk
